CVE-2026-9934: Use after free in Aura in Google Chrome prior to 148
Use after free in Aura in Google Chrome prior to 148.0.7778.216 allowed a remote attacker who convinced a user to engage in specific UI gestures to execute arbitrary code via a crafted HTML page. (Chromium security severity: High)

HarborGuard analysisSynopsis
Use-after-free in the Aura UI framework component of Google Chrome (versions prior to 148.0.7778.216) all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the victim's machine. The vulnerability is reachable over the network but requires the attacker to convince a target user to perform specific UI gestures, typically through a crafted HTML page delivered via a malicious or compromised site. Successful exploitation gives the attacker full code execution in the context of the browser process. AvailableExploit Conditions
- Network reachabilityRequired
The attacker delivers the crafted HTML page over the network, so the victim's browser must be able to reach attacker-controlled content via a standard internet connection.
- AuthenticationNot required
No account or credentials are required; the attacker only needs to lure the target to a malicious page.
- Victim interactionRequired
The victim must perform specific UI gestures on the crafted page, making social engineering a necessary step in the attack chain.
- Attack complexityDetail
Exploit reliability is reduced by high attack complexity, meaning the attacker likely depends on specific browser state, memory layout, or timing conditions to trigger the use-after-free reliably.
Blast Radius
- Attacker executes arbitrary code in the context of the Chrome browser process on the victim's machine.
- Confidentiality impact is high: the attacker can read browser memory, stored credentials, session tokens, and other data accessible to the process.
- Integrity impact is high: the attacker can write or modify data within the process and interact with the underlying OS at the browser's privilege level.
- Availability impact is high: the attacker can crash the browser process or render it unresponsive.
